Coinbase offers multiple ways to manage cryptocurrencies, including the Coinbase Chrome Extension and the Coinbase Wallet App. While both tools allow you to send, receive, and store digital assets, they are designed for different use cases. Understanding their differences helps users choose the right solution for managing crypto securely and efficiently.
The Coinbase Chrome Extension is a browser-based wallet that allows you to access and manage cryptocurrencies directly from your browser. It integrates with decentralized applications (dApps) and provides quick access to accounts while keeping private keys encrypted and stored locally. It is ideal for users who frequently interact with Web3 applications from their desktop.
Coinbase Wallet App is a mobile application available for iOS and Android. It provides full wallet functionality, including multi-currency support, portfolio tracking, dApp connectivity, and secure storage of private keys. The app is designed for on-the-go crypto management and allows seamless access to your assets anytime, anywhere.
| Feature | Coinbase Chrome Extension | Coinbase Wallet App |
|---|---|---|
| Platform | Desktop browser (Chrome, Firefox) | Mobile (iOS & Android) |
| Accessibility | Quick access through browser | Portable access anywhere via mobile |
| Private Key Storage | Encrypted locally in browser | Encrypted locally on device |
| dApp Integration | Directly with browser-based dApps | Supports mobile dApps via WalletConnect |
| Multi-Currency Support | Supports major tokens | Supports hundreds of cryptocurrencies |
| Transactions | Send, receive, and sign transactions in browser | Send, receive, swap, and track portfolio |
| Updates | Updated through browser extension store | Updated through App Store or Google Play |
